Sports broadcasting is one of the most significant applications of digital broadcast switchers. These switchers are used to manage multiple camera feeds, instant replays, and live graphics integration. With the growing popularity of live sports events and eSports, broadcasters are increasingly investing in advanced switchers to enhance viewer experience and ensure seamless production quality. Trends such as 4K and 8K resolution broadcasting further fuel the demand for high-performance switchers in this segment.
In studio production, digital broadcast switchers are used to control video sources, manage transitions, and integrate special effects during live broadcasts and recorded programs. The rise of streaming platforms and online content creation has boosted the need for efficient production tools, making digital switchers indispensable. Automated workflows and AI-driven production tools are emerging trends shaping this market.
News production relies on digital broadcast switchers for real-time editing, multi-camera feeds, and seamless content transitions. The fast-paced nature of news broadcasting requires highly responsive switchers capable of handling live feeds efficiently. The adoption of virtual and augmented reality (VR/AR) technologies in newsrooms is also driving innovation in this segment.

Production switchers are widely used in live broadcasts, television studios, and remote productions. They offer advanced features such as multi-camera support, real-time effects, and customizable transitions. The shift towards IP-based broadcasting and cloud-based production is shaping the future of production switchers.
Routing switchers are essential for managing and distributing audio and video signals in broadcasting environments. These switchers are crucial for television networks, post-production studios, and satellite broadcasting. The increasing demand for high-speed data transmission and efficient content management systems is driving growth in this segment.
Master control switchers are used in television stations and broadcast networks to manage multiple channels, advertisements, and emergency broadcasts. With the rise of digital and OTT (over-the-top) streaming services, broadcasters are investing in advanced master control switchers to ensure seamless content delivery and network management.
